No Rest For the Wicked Archer Build

Unlike most RPGs,No Rest for the Wickeddoesn’t use a class system that determines your initial attribute spread. Instead, you start with 10 points in each attribute, and your build will depend on how you allocate your points as you level up.

In this guide, we’ll walk you through a build that usesDexterityas the main stat—an early-gameArcher builddesigned for levels 1–10.

Gear and Spells

For theArcher build,we’ll be using theShort Bowas our main weapon in the offhand slot. This build emphasizes a different playstyle—rather than relying on your main-hand weapon, you’ll prioritize using your offhand bow.

That said, you’ll still need a main-hand weapon to generateFocusfor your arrow shots. For this, we’ll be using aone-handed knifeweapon.

The Bow, being an offhand weapon, cannot be used for standard attacks. All bow attacks costFocus, making it essential to have a melee weapon to parry or land hits in order to generateFocus.

Armor Pieces

For armor, we recommend theWretched Archerleather set in the early game, as it keeps yourequip loadlow. The goal is to maintain aNormal Weight Classso you can dodge effectively without being slowed down.

While it’s possible to equip heavier armor like theMesh set, doing so will push you into theHeavy Weight Class, which reduces mobility and undermines the build’s strengths. Only use heavier armor if you’re comfortable with the slower roll.

Enchantments and Affixes

For the enchantments onthe pieces of gear, we’re going to wantaffixesthat are going to help us deal with managingbecause the bow is soFocus-pointdependent when using it. Ideally, we’ll want to search for affixes such as additional gain and reducedFocuscost on our equipment.

HavingFocus efficiencyas a priority will enable you to shoot off your arrows easily so that you can use the bow to its full potential while keeping you at a distance from enemies.

For curses, avoid affixes that hinder your resource efficiency—like higher ability costs, combat drain, or slower recovery. These significantly weaken the build, so it’s best to re-roll them if the gear is worth keeping, or swap to a different piece altogether.

Another strong option is anAgility Ring, which increases movement speed and reduces stamina costs—perfect for enhancing an agile playstyle.

Forgems, even though you won’t find many to infuse into your gear at this stage of the game, you’ll want to prioritize ones that bolster your Focus stat—Chipped Jewels, in particular—as increasing your Focus pool will allow you to fire off more arrow shots.

Other useful gems to look out for include theChipped Topaz, which increases Focus gain, and theChipped Moon Stone, which regenerates Focus during combat. Infusing these will make managing your Focus points much easier and make the build more comfortable to use overall.

In the early game, you can either infuse the gems you find or save them for later, as they aren’t essential to the build just yet.

Final Thoughts

No Rest for the Wickedcan be punishing if you start with a weak setup. ThisArcher buildprovides a solid foundation for the early game, but it requires practice and awareness.

Keep in mind: using the bow as a primary weapon plays very differently from other styles. You’ll still need to land melee hits to gain Focus, and mastering parry timing is essential—each successful parry grants 100 Focus, enough to eliminate most enemies with your bow.
